Section 44: Latrines and Urinals

The Rajasthan Cinemas (Regulation) Rules, 1959State Rules of Rajasthan · 2023

(1) Every cinema, shall be provided with separate latrines and urinals for the use of males and females. Such latrines shall be respectively to a minimum scale of one and two per hundred seats.

(2) In places where water supply is available water flushed latrines and urinals shall be provided, and where such supply is not available they shall be detached from the main building and shall be maintained in a sanitary condition and shall be drained in a soak pit.

(3) Water flushed latrines and urinals shall discharge into a septic tank or sewer which shall be at least 16 ft. by 3 ft. by 6ft. deep and shall be provided with two main holes with covers, sluge pipes, valves and chambers for cleaning. Effluent from such tank and sewer shall discharge into a soak pit.

(4) Latrines and urinals, shall be constructed and maintained to the satisfaction of the Medical Officer of Health and shall be cleaned and rendered effectively disinfected after each performance.
